Detailed explanation-1: -Children will learn about phonemes during phonics, the study of sounds. For instance, they might learn how the word ‘dog’ is made up of three phonemes: /d/, /o/ and /g/.

Detailed explanation-2: -It is a letter or letter combination that represents a single phoneme within a word. A grapheme is a spelling of a phoneme. Digraphs are graphemes spelled with more than one letter, usually two. We need many digraphs because English has more phonemes (42) than letters (26).

Detailed explanation-3: -For example, the word “shin” has three phonemes: “sh” “i” and “n."
